Melanella mamilla explained

Melanella mamilla is a species of sea snail, a marine gastropod mollusk in the family Eulimidae.[1]

Distribution

This marine species is endemic to Australia and occurs off Tasmania.

References

External links

Notes and References

  1. MolluscaBase eds. (2020). MolluscaBase. Melanella mamilla (May, 1915). Accessed through: World Register of Marine Species at: https://www.marinespecies.org/aphia.php?p=taxdetails&id=827855 on 2020-11-11